Transaction 89f3312b23b76b4091bf18d4394e9c4c182b26e6ef19e2be2e94bbb4b1e57429

1 Input
2 Outputs
  • 89f3312b23b76b4091bf18d4394e9c4c182b26e6ef19e2be2e94bbb4b1e57429:0
  • value  1949922722
    address  2N2fC2tr5uGmviLVM7CfFatfx7btH37xkMD
  • 89f3312b23b76b4091bf18d4394e9c4c182b26e6ef19e2be2e94bbb4b1e57429:1
  • value  347404
    address  2NBMEXzz3DUS3CK8FLkQB29Am3CYDxLvNTT